"Is the run up to intervention in Iran deja vu all over again?

It had damn well better not be!

The drumbeat in some Washington foreign policy circles for 'regime change' in Iran has striking similarities to the run-up to the Iraq invasion, and is being led by some of the usual suspects -- like the American Enterprise Institute's Michael Ledeen.

Though not well-known outside of Washington, Ledeen's 'views virtually define the stark departure from American foreign policy philosophy that existed before the tragedy of Sep. 11, 2001,' Pacific News Service's William Beeman commented in May 2003.

'He basically believes that violence in the service of the spread of democracy is America's manifest destiny. Consequently, he has become the philosophical legitimator of the American occupation of Iraq.' "
